Understanding the Role of a MySQL Administrator

Key Responsibilities and Daily Tasks

Key Responsibilities and Daily Tasks

As a MySQL Administrator, the peimary responsibility is to ensure the smooth operation and performance of MySQL databases. This involves a variety of daily tasks that are crucial for maintaining data integrity, security, and availability. One of the key responsibilities is monitoring database performance. Administrators regularly check for slow queries, analyze performance metrics, and optimize database configurations to enhance speed and efficiency. This proactive approach helps in identifying potential issues before they escalate into significant problems.

Another essential task is managing user access and security. MySQL Administrators are responsible for setting up user accounts, defining roles, and implementing security measures to protect sensitive data. This includes configuring permissions and ensuring that only authorized personnel have access to specific databases. Regular audits and updates to security protocols are also part of the daily routine, ensuring compliance with best practices and organizational policies.

Backup and recovery processes are critical components of a MySQL Administrator’s duties. Daily tasks often include scheduling regular backups, verifying their integrity, and testing recovery procedures to ensure that data can be restored quickly in case of a failure. This not only safeguards against data loss but also instills confidence in the reliability of the database systems.

Additionally, MySQL Administrators engage in routine maintenance tasks such as updating software, applying patches, and performing database migrations when necessary. These activities are vital for keeping the database environment up-to-date and secure. By efficiently managing these responsibilities, MySQL Administrators can ensure that their databases run smoothly, allowing organizations to leverage their data effectively.

Best Practices for Efficient Database Management

Strategies to Optimize Performance and Speed

To optimize database performance and speed, implementing best practices is essential. One effective strategy involves indexing frequently queried columns. This can significantly reduce the time required to retrieve data. Quick access is crucial for maintaining efficiency.

Another important practice is to regularly analyze and optimize queries. By identifying slow-running queries, he can make necessary adjustments to improve their execution time. This proactive approach minimizes potential bottlenecks. Regular reviews are vital for sustained performance.

Additionally, maintaining proper database configuration settings is critical. He should ensure that memory allocation and buffer sizes are optimized for the workload. Proper configuration can lead to enhanced performance. Small adjustments can yield significant improvements.

Routine maintenance tasks, such as purging old data, also contribute to overall efficiency. By removing unnecessary data, he can reduce the database size and improve response times. A lean database is easier to manage.

Finally, monitoring performance metrics continuously allows for timely interventions. By keeping an eye on key indicators, he can address issues before tmey escalate. Early detection is key to maintaining optimal performance.
